A few questions.....
I'm running a Roland Mc505 and cakewalk pro 8.  I grabbed the 
cakewalk ins' definition file from the vault here on the list, but 
when attempting to load it in cakewalk it says this: "not a valid ins 
definititon file"???  The file is only 6kb.  Can anyone verify if 
this file is corrupt or better yet email me the new one.   Also can i 
run two instrument definition files at once?  Ie send controller data 
to the 505 and send controller data to the An1x.   Currently i'm 
using the 505 inst' def' file and it's making the An1x do 
unpredictable things.   I have ordered a midi sport 4x4 and that 
should help the connection side of things.

About INS - I think you got corrupted - I can't check it 'cause I am not
having AN1x inst.def. file but they are usually larger ..
About having more than one ..
You load all instruments you have/need into the list first on the "Define
Instruments and names" window ...
And then in :
"Assign instruments" (in Cake 9 it's in Options/Instruments) you assign
different instrument definitions to different midi channels / ports ..
For example my "Roland UM-4 Port 1" 1-16 channels are assigned to EMU
Proteus Ins.Def. and "Roland UM-4 Port 2" 1-2 Channels are assigned to
AN-1x def. and so on ..
